UNIVERSITIES Minister David Willetts has had to pull out of a discussion event at Oxford University.
Mr Willetts was due to appear on Monday but cannot attend because of parliamentary commitments.
The university is hosting a series of public events, starting on Monday at the Examination Schools in High Street to “consider the role of the humanities in addressing contemporary challenges”.
Organised by the Oxford Research Centre in the Humanities (TORCH), the event will be chaired by Prof Shearer West, Head of the Humanities Division at Oxford University and will feature Prof Marcus du Sautoy and Dame Hermione Lee of Oxford University, as well as Guardian chief arts writer Charlotte Higgins. A fortnightly seminar series will begin the following day.
